ND53 WJJ is a 2003 Nissan Terrano in Gold with a 2,953cc diesel engine. This vehicle has been through 28 MOT tests with a personal pass rate of 60.7%.
Across all 2003 Nissan Terrano models, the average MOT pass rate is 69.3% with a typical mileage of 77,403 miles. This particular vehicle has a lower pass rate than the average for its year, which may indicate maintenance issues worth investigating.
The most common reason a Nissan Terrano fails its MOT is brake pipe excessively corroded, accounting for 34,504 recorded failures. If you're considering buying ND53 WJJ, it's worth having these areas checked by a mechanic before committing.
The Nissan Terrano typically stays on UK roads for around 33 years. At 23 years old, this Nissan Terrano is well into its expected lifespan but still has years ahead.
